Flags are a popular and eye-catching outdoor advertising tool used by businesses, organizations, and individuals to promote their brand, message, or event. Flags come in various shapes, sizes, and materials, including fabric, vinyl, and mesh, and can be customized with high-quality graphics, images, and text.

Pros and Cons of Flags

The benefits of using flags include:

One of the main benefits of flags is their high visibility. Flags are designed to move and wave in the wind, which attracts attention and makes them stand out. They are also versatile in terms of their application, as they can be used for various purposes, such as promoting a new product or service, advertising a special event, or showcasing national pride. Additionally, flags are easy to install and can be placed in high-traffic areas, such as on lawns, street corners, or alongside busy roads.

Drawbacks of using flags include:

However, there are some drawbacks to using flags as well. For instance, flags may not be suitable for all types of businesses or events, as they can be seen as less professional or formal than other forms of advertising. Additionally, flags can be damaged by weather conditions, such as strong winds or heavy rain, which may affect their durability and longevity. Another drawback is that flags may not be effective in areas with low wind or in indoor settings.

Overall, flags are a highly visible and versatile outdoor advertising option for businesses and organizations looking to promote their brand or message. Whether you choose flags or other forms of outdoor advertising will depend on your specific needs and requirements.
